一辆行驶里程约2060km、配置2.0T发动机的2016年凯迪拉克ATS-L轿车。这是一辆使用没多久的新车,客户反映在店提车的时候就发生过无法启动的现象,当时认为没油了,加了几升油进去,又能发动着车。
后来在使用的过程中又出现过几次突然熄火的现象,有时跑一两百千米出现一次,有时跑三四百千米出现一次,没什么规律。
每次熄火后重新启动时,都不容易着车,但等一会儿还是能发动着车。这次又在高速公路上突然熄火,发动后行驶了几分钟再次熄火,只能叫拖车拖回我公司维修。
故障诊断:维修前,技师考虑到该车已经停放了一个晚上,准备先怠速暖车后再路试。打开点火钥匙,能一次启动着车,除了发动机故障灯已点亮外没有其他异常。正当怠速过程中却发现发动机突然熄火,此时水温表显示刚到中间位置。再次发动,不着车,经过反复试验,技师发现冷车启动正常,热车容易自动熄火,而且熄火现象似乎是燃油供不上的特征。
由于发动机故障灯点亮,有故障码存在,决定先读取故障码分析,再决定维修方案。连接诊断仪读取到如下的故障,如图1所示。
DTC P0627:燃油泵启用电路;P0629:燃油泵启用电路电压过高;P069E:燃油泵控制模块请求点亮故障指示灯;底盘控制模块还存储P025A:燃油泵控制模块启用电路。
阅读维修手册,查询这几个故障码的含义如下:
(1)DTC P0627:燃油泵启用电路;DTC P0629淤幻由泵启用电路电压过高。
电路/系统说明:只要发动机启动或运行,发动机控制模块(ECM)就向底盘控制模块提供点火电压。只要发动机正在启动或运行且接收到点火系统参考脉冲,发动机控制模块就会启用底盘控制模块。收到该启用电压时,底盘控制模块向内装式燃油泵模块提供变化的电压,以维持需要的燃油管路压力。运行DTC的条件:发动机转速大于。;点火电压高于11V;燃油泵启用电路被指令接通。满足上述条件时,此DTC将持续运行。
设置DTC的条件:发动机控制模块检测到驱动器的指令状态和控制电路的实际状态不匹配超过2.5s。
(2)DTC P069E:燃油泵控制模块请求点亮故障指示灯。
电路/系统说明:底盘控制模块(有时也称为燃油泵控制模块)持续检测燃油泵控制系统中是否有可能对车辆排放装置产生不利影响的任何故障。如果检测到故障,底盘控制模块则设置一个DTC,并向发动机控制模块(ECM)发送一个串行数据信息。发动机控制模块设置DTC P069E,告知技术人员底盘控制模块已设置了排放相关DTC。底盘控制模块向发动机控制模块发送的串行数据信息也含有点亮故障指示灯(MIL)的请求。
设置DTC条件:发动机控制模块收到底盘控制模块发送的串行数据信息,指示底盘控制模块中已设置了排放相关DTC。
(3)底盘控制模块故障代码DTCP025:燃油泵控制模块启用电路。
电路/系统说明:当发动机控制模块检测到点火开关打开时,发动机控制模块向底盘控制模块提供电压。除非发动机正在启动或运转,否则发动机控制模块将向底盘控制模块提供2s电压。收到该电压时,底盘控制模块向燃油箱燃油泵模块提供变化的电压,以维持需要的燃油管路压力。
设置DTC的条件:发动机控制模块发送至底盘控制模块的串行数据信息与发动机控制模块发送至底盘控制模块的控制启用电压信号不一致,并持续2s以上。
经过对故障码含义的分析和理解,结合本车的故障现象,初步判断故障可能出现在以下几个方面:①发动机控制模块故障;②底盘控制模块故障;③线路故障;④车内电磁干扰。
考虑到是新车,没有发生过碰撞和进水,控制模块出现问题的可能性较小。该车没做过改装,没有加装非原厂件,可以排除电磁干扰。估计线路上出现问题的可能性较大,或许是线路本身质量的问题,也可能是装配的问题,需要进一步检查才能确定故障原因。